eBanking.com was left to expire and dropped, caught by DropCatch and closed at $56,939. The domain name was owned by BGL BNP Paribas out of Luxembourg. The name was not paid for and is now being reauctioned.
DropCatch will re-auction their names and had to do it many times last year on ePara.com.
